Serif Flared Egte 8 is a regular weight, narrow, medium cont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

This serif typeface shows sturdy, slightly condensed proportions with a steady rhythm and moderate stroke contrast. Serifs are finely cut and often bracket into the stems, while many stroke endings subtly flare, giving the letters a sculpted, chiseled finish rather than a blunt slab. Curves are full but controlled, with open counters and crisp joins; diagonals and arms terminate cleanly, keeping the texture firm in running text. The lowercase features a two-storey a and g, compact bowls, and relatively short extenders, producing an even, bookish color.

It suits long-form reading such as books, essays, and magazines, where its steady texture and open counters help maintain clarity. The authoritative caps and firm numerals also work well for editorial headlines, academic or institutional materials, and brand systems that want a traditional, established voice.

Overall, the font reads as traditional and authoritative, with a calm, literary tone. The flared endings add a faintly monumental, engraved character that feels established rather than trendy, lending a measured seriousness to headlines and paragraphs alike.

The design appears intended to provide a dependable old-style reading experience with a slightly carved, flared finishing that adds distinction without becoming decorative. It balances classical serif conventions with crisp, modernized edges for confident use in both text and display settings.

Capitals are robust and slightly weighty, with a stable stance and clear internal space (notably in C, G, O, and Q). Numerals are lining and similarly solid, with strong vertical emphasis and clear differentiation at display sizes.
